Yes, with the game Tophet. The whole book, Tyler struggled with the power his dad over him. Every time he would play the game, he would lose. Finally, after taking power from his father, Tyler wins the game. "The confrontation with the Dark Lord was thirty-seven minutes of mad skills and sick mayhem. I won. I beat the game. And then a new screen, one I had never seen before, never even heard of, popped up. It gave me a choice. I could become the new Lord of Darkness myself, or I could take a gamble and be reincarnated. - I chose wisely" (249-250). The choice also doubled as a significance between the relationship with his father.

The theme of "Twisted" by Laurie Halse Anderson revolves around the consequences of actions, the struggles of adolescence, and the importance of communication and understanding within families. The book explores themes of identity, societal pressure, and redemption as the protagonist tries to navigate high school and personal challenges.
